Second Recruit Opts to Play at Missouri, Not Washington
COLUMBIA, Mo. (AP) — A second high school prospect who initially committed to Washington before the Huskies' coach was fired last month says he will instead play basketball at Missouri. Blake Harris, a 6-foot-3 point guard from Raleigh, North Carolina, announced Sunday on Twitter that he will play for the Tigers under new coach Cuonzo Martin...

QB Falk Returns as Washington St. Seeks 3rd Straight Bowl
SPOKANE, Wash. (AP) — The return of record-setting quarterback Luke Falk for his senior year highlights Thursday's opening of spring practice for the Washington State football team, which is seeking a third consecutive bowl game. The Cougars have 15 returning starters, including All-America offensive guard Cody O'Connell, a trio of established running backs and veteran linebackers Peyton Pelluer a

Mika Leads BYU to Upset of No. 1 Gonzaga 79-71
SPOKANE, Wash. (AP) — Eric Mika had 29 points and 11 rebounds to help BYU upset No. 1 Gonzaga 79-71 on Saturday night, ending the Bulldogs' quest to go undefeated in the final game of the regular season. Nigel Williams-Goss scored 19 points for Gonzaga (29-1, 17-1 West Coast), which was seeking to become the first team since Kentucky in 2014-15 to finish the regular season without a loss... Read M
